So, I constantly see 16+ toons with 25% mounts, some in their mid 20's. If I have the spare cash on that toon, I'll toss 'em 20g and tell them to buy a 50% one. Nearly always I get, "OMG! Thank you so much!" in various forms. I have seen/experienced this to the extent that I believe it is an issue. However, relying on gamers to be generous is not really a solution. 10g by rank 16 for a starting player can be a tough nut. Especially, since they probably spend their precious currency on things they don't need, will quickly level out of, or on flying around exploring. I've played a lot of toons on this server, freshly leveling in countless states of the game. Outside of the outright broken SC kill quest "bug" days of T3 cap, w/o mailing from an Alt, you have to grind a bit for that gold, and that's if you spend 0g on travel/gear/tali's/pots and other various useless expenses in T1.
I propose a 50% mount quest. Give it from the mount vendors themselves, I would suggest a quest tied to crafting skills in order to help nubs learn ways to make gold. It would be great if there was one quest line for each crafting set(Butcher/Scavenge/Cult/etc) offering different colored mounts, but even a standard Gather/Kill/Travel/Capture/Epic quest line reward would be fine as crafting quests could take a lot of work. The only people that would generally be taking this quest would be newbies or players starting an alt that can't afford 10g. Either way it wouldn't be game breaking(imo), but simply a method for the very new to have a QoL upgrade the rest of us consider a gold sink. If a straight up 10g questline isn't wanted, then make the mount last 30days(cause, y'know it's just that simple...).
The difficulty would be letting new players know the quest even exists. Starting the quest from the Mount Vendors in the City/WC would help. Adding it to the loading screen messages would help as well. Maybe a general T1 questline that starts at the racial starting point offering crafting quests and others before giving you that mount long before you can use it as incentive to lvl up.
Definitely not a high priority, and yes I have called this server "care-bear" in the past(and believe it today). I think too much is simply given to players. But the 50% mount is just mandatory if you want to exit the WC/SC spawn in mid-tier ORvR. So why not give them a quest-chain they can hopefully learn something about the game from. They might stay longer, or be more willing to try a new class if that 10g isn't hanging over their head.
